Abstract

A formulation is presented to evaluate the critical length of an elastic long column that buckles due to its own-weight. The column is modeled as a serial assembly of rigid links and virtual springs that stand for the flexural rigidity of the column. The critical length is searched by the dynamic criterion as the one that makes the lowest natural frequency equal to zero, which is derived by the condition that the sum of the kinetic energy, strain energy and gravitational energy of the column vibration is kept constant. The numerical examples of an aluminum column demonstrates the validity of the present formulation.
